A study of the reign of Charles V constructed around a biographical framework and looking at his role in the German Reformation, the establishment of the state of the Netherlands, the formation of the Spanish overseas empire and the Habsburg-Valois rivalry in Italy.

Charles V was elected Holy Roman Emperor and, until his death in 1558, he was to play a central role on the European political stage. The book is a clear introduction to the often confusing train of events in the first half of the sixteenth century. It looks at Charles''s response to the Protestant Reformation in Germany; his efforts to retain the Netherlands under Habsburg control; his struggle with France for domination over Italy; and his attempts to check the expansion of Ottoman power in the Mediterranean.
